What Digital Marketing Actually Covers in 2026
Digital marketing is the practice of using online channels such as search engines and social media and email and paid advertising to reach the people most likely to become customers. Instead of relying only on traditional advertising it uses measurable digital channels to connect a business with its target audience and track exactly what is working.
The goal is simple even when the execution is not. Increase visibility where your customers are already looking. Generate leads that are actually qualified. Turn visitors into repeat customers over time rather than one time buyers.

Why SEO Specifically Deserves Extra Attention
SEO helps a website appear higher in search results without paying for every click. Unlike paid advertising the traffic it brings continues even after the initial work is done. A well optimized page published a year ago can still bring in customers today while a paid ad stops the moment the budget runs out.
According to Google own SEO starter guide the fundamentals that matter most are making a site easy for search engines to crawl and creating content that genuinely helps the people reading it and building a site that loads quickly and works well on mobile. None of that has changed even as search itself has evolved to include AI generated summaries alongside traditional results.
A Simple SEO Checklist to Start With
| SEO Task | Why It Matters |
|---|---|
| Keyword research | Helps target what your actual customers are searching for |
| Clear and honest titles | Improves both search visibility and click through rate |
| Genuinely helpful content | Answers real customer questions instead of padding word count |
| Fast page speed | Keeps visitors from leaving before the page even loads |
| Quality backlinks | Builds the trust signals search engines rely on |
| Regular content updates | Keeps older pages relevant instead of going stale |

How Small Businesses Specifically Benefit
Small businesses often work with limited budgets which makes every marketing dollar matter more than it does for a larger company. Digital marketing works well here because it lets a business start small and measure what works and reinvest in the channels producing real results rather than guessing.
Picture a small local bakery. Instead of waiting for foot traffic to discover the shop by chance the owner optimizes the website for local search and posts regularly on Instagram and runs a small targeted ad campaign and publishes a few genuinely useful blog posts about baking. Over a few months more local customers find the business online and visit in person and start recommending it to others. None of this requires a large budget just consistency.

What Realistic Growth Looks Like Over Time
Results vary by industry and competition and starting point but a consistent strategy applied over roughly six months tends to show clear and measurable movement rather than an overnight jump. A site starting from very little visibility might see organic traffic grow several times over and ranking keywords expand meaningfully and lead volume increase steadily as the content and technical foundation both mature. Anyone promising a dramatic result within days is either describing a very small and low competition niche or setting expectations that will not hold up.
A Few Questions Business Owners Actually Ask
Is digital marketing worth it for a small business with a limited budget? Often more so than for a large company since a small business cannot usually sustain paid advertising indefinitely and needs channels that keep producing results without constant new spend.
How long does SEO take to show results? Most businesses begin seeing noticeable movement within three to six months though this depends heavily on competition and how much work the site needs.
Which channel delivers the fastest results? Paid advertising typically generates traffic and leads the fastest while SEO and content marketing build slower but far more durable long term growth.
Why does digital marketing matter for every type of business? It lets a business reach the specific people already looking for what it offers and track results honestly and improve continuously instead of guessing at what traditional advertising might be doing.
